Increased mRNA translation delays tumor initiation and exposes a therapeutic vulnerability in lung cancer

Summary
Although protein synthesis inhibitors are being evaluated as anti-cancer agents, the dynamics of mRNA translation in early tumorigenesis are still poorly understood. We report that deletion of the mRNA-translation repressor, eIF4A2 in early KRAS-driven lung adenocarcinoma leads to a dysregulated protein synthesis landscape characterised by a strongly upregulated secretome, enlarged secretory compartments, increased oxidative metabolism and acquisition of senescence-like characteristics. Paradoxically, this overdriven protein synthesis landscape delays tumorigenesis and leads to appearance of clusters of non-proliferative, p21-positive KRAS-expressing cells in the lung. Administration of rapamycin to reduce mRNA translation, suppresses senescence and restores tumorigenesis following eIF4A2 deletion. Importantly, some eIF4A2 deleted cells overcome senescence to form tumors that growth aggressively. Analysis of these eIF4A2-deleted tumors through a combination of multiplex imaging and spatial transcriptomics pointed to a rewiring of KRAS downstream pathways through enhanced MAP-kinase and reduced PI3K signalling. Consequently, these tumors may be eradicated by administration of a MEK inhibitor, in contrast to eIF4A2 positive lesions. Thus, dysregulated mRNA translation exposes a potential therapeutic vulnerability in KRAS-driven lung adenocarcinoma by forcing cancer cells to rely on MEK signalling.
